Transaction dc106e37bd2e3f2760670fb2c00ce3d6bfaa4404713196d1c32e06fa401223e2
1 Input
1 Output
-
dc106e37bd2e3f2760670fb2c00ce3d6bfaa4404713196d1c32e06fa401223e2:0
- value
- 8126202
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6f669768259420ed8e67fe3242a21c3902d688e OP_EQUAL
- address
- 3MHdibgzeJRvRR3XMsMgdFLmySs6mfgeio